Originally Posted by tom14cat14 View Post
For those curious the Union said they just signed LOA for Pilots hired Jan 1st 2015-July 1st 2015 to have their version of the SSP. The basics seems like they get the same thing as SSP except they have a requirement to be Captain for 2 years at Endeavor. This is because the company believes the Upgrade time will be closer to 24 months than it currently is.

As was noted ALL Endeavor pilots will be covered under a preferential Delta interview (SSP- Streamlined Selection Process). As I mentioned before, Delta is providing a lot support and money to Endeavor as a whole, with specific programs for pilots. I think it's the way regionals ought to run, save for being fully fledged mainline employees from top to bottom. And yes, I understand/respect that mainline Delta employees value their culture and want to vet potential new hires instead of have a flow.

Also, I'm can't think of a way that the Bloch award will really affect new hires directly or indirectly...maybe that is confusing to newbies. Thought I should clarify for all the job hunters out there.
